About Carey, Idaho

Carey is a locality in Blaine County, Idaho, United States. It has a population of approximately 1,196. The population density is 134.0 people per km². Carey is located at 43.3077°N, 113.9448°W. It observes the Mountain Time (America/Boise) timezone. ZIP code: 83320.

Carey sits at the wide mouth of a valley that spills into the arid, sagebrush-scented plains of southern Idaho. It lies 57.7 miles north-north-east of Twin Falls, ID (from Twin Falls, ID: bearing 27°T), and is situated 19.2 miles south-east of Bellevue. The history of Carey is deeply intertwined with the agricultural bounty that the Snake River Plain has, with persistent effort, yielded. For generations, the economy has pulsed with the seasons, driven by the cultivation of potatoes, sugar beets, and alfalfa, crops that demand both grit and a profound understanding of the land. This industrious spirit is echoed in the town's very foundation, a place born from the ambition to harness the region's fertile soil and connect it to broader markets. The Union Pacific Railroad, a vital artery in the nation's expansion, played a significant role in Carey's development, its tracks a silver ribbon stitching this remote outpost to the wider world.
